Are you consistently dealing with the 'Moisture Detected in Charging Port' error on your Samsung Galaxy phone?

There could be numerous reasons behind encountering this issue, with one main possibility being exposure to water.

In our video, we detail how to eliminate this error and effectively clean the charging port on your Samsung device.

Proven fix:
1: Turn phone on
2: Wait until samsung logo dissappears
3: As soon as logo disappears insert charger.

This bypasses the start up software and bypasses the software fault. Make sure you insert charger just as the logo disappears.
